/*
* JSON writing functions.
*/
#pragma once
#include <stddef.h>
#include <wchar.h>
#include <cmath> // for std::isinf, std::isnan; as C99 macros are unavailable in C++11
#include <iomanip>
#include <limits>
#include <ostream>
#include <string>
class JSONWriter
{
private:
std::ostream &os;
int level;
bool value;
char space;
void
newline(void);
void
separator(void);
public:
JSONWriter(std::ostream &_os);
~JSONWriter();
void
beginObject();
void
endObject();
void
beginMember(const char * name);
inline void
beginMember(const std::string &name) {
beginMember(name.c_str());
}
void
endMember(void);
void
beginArray();
void
endArray(void);
void
writeString(const char *s);
inline void
writeString(const std::string &s) {
writeString(s.c_str());
}
void
writeBase64(const void *bytes, size_t size);
void
writeNull(void);
void
writeBool(bool b);
/**
* Special case for char to prevent it to be written as a literal
* character.
*/
inline void
writeInt(signed char n) {
separator();
os << std::dec << static_cast<int>(n);
value = true;
space = ' ';
}
inline void
writeInt(unsigned char n) {
separator();
os << std::dec << static_cast<unsigned>(n);
value = true;
space = ' ';
}
template<class T>
inline void
writeInt(T n) {
separator();
os << std::dec << n;
value = true;
space = ' ';
}
template<class T>
void
writeFloat(T n) {
separator();
if (std::isnan(n)) {
// NaN is non-standard but widely supported
os << "NaN";
} else if (std::isinf(n)) {
// Infinite is non-standard but widely supported
if (n < 0) {
os << '-';
}
os << "Infinity";
} else {
os << std::dec << std::setprecision(std::numeric_limits<T>::digits10 + 1) << n;
}
value = true;
space = ' ';
}
};
